Part Overview

The SM671PXB-ADSS is a FLASH NAND (SLC) memory integrated circuit manufactured by Silicon Motion, Inc., with a capacity of 80Gbit and UFS3.1 interface. This component is packaged in a 153-TFBGA (11.5x13mm) surface mount configuration and operates across a temperature range of -25°C to 85°C. The part is classified as obsolete, necessitating identification of functionally equivalent alternatives for ongoing design support and procurement requirements.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The SM671PXB-AFSS serves as a direct functional equivalent to the SM671PXB-ADSS. Both components share identical electrical specifications, memory capacity, interface protocol, and physical packaging. The primary distinction is product status: the SM671PXB-ADSS is classified as obsolete, while the SM671PXB-AFSS maintains active status.

For new designs and ongoing production requirements, the SM671PXB-AFSS is the appropriate selection. Both parts maintain ROHS3 compliance and identical moisture sensitivity specifications, ensuring compatibility with current manufacturing and environmental standards.
